Résumé

Ten undescribed alkaloids, named integerrines A-J, including one racemic heterodimer of carbazole and indole, two racemic, two scalemic, and one enantiomerically enriched biscarbazoles, two aldoximes, and one racemic pyrrolone, were isolated from the dried leaves and stems of Micromelum integerrimum. The racemic or scalemic compounds were resolved using chiral-phase HPLC and their configurations were determined by comparison of experimental and calculated ECD data.
